Facebook Keeps Slipping

March 23rd, 2026 Edition


Most of the top domains eased off a little this week -- unremarkable on its own; these scores wiggle around all the time.

The one worth watching is Facebook. It dropped again, and it's now lower than it was during the dip earlier this month -- a brief recovery in between didn't hold. Over the past month, it's the biggest decliner among the sites that show up when someone searches for a therapist.

And there's a flip side. LinkedIn hit a new recent high while most things around it fell, and Psychology Today tightened its grip on the very top of the page. So the two leaders aren't just holding -- they're slowly pulling away.

LinkedIn is the standout -- up while the rest of the field slipped, and the most visible site for therapists by a comfortable margin. Psychology Today sits just behind it on overall visibility but, as always, owns the actual top of the page. Below the two of them, most domains gave back a little ground.

Two movers stand out, for opposite reasons. The NPI lookup site npiprofile fell sharply -- but that just unwinds an odd one-week jump it had recently, so it's a non-story. Facebook is the one that matters: its drop here is part of a steady decline, not a blip.

Psychology Today strengthened its hold on the #1 spot, now taking close to half of it. If your profile is there, that result is almost certainly on page one when someone searches your name -- and it's getting harder, not easier, for anything to dislodge it.


That's it for this week. The main story: Facebook keeps sliding, while LinkedIn and Psychology Today pull a little further ahead.
